Re: [Sheepshead] Any Ohio Sheephead players?

Hi, Your message is confusing. You mentioned 24 cards instead of 32. Which 8
cards aren't included in your "new" version, and how is the scoring different.
Is this a "called ace" version and how many players in a game?

There are numerous versions: For example, 6-handed (dealer sits out);
7-handed and all players sit in each getting 4 (yes, FOUR) cards and 4 cards in
the blind. The first person who wants to "pick" may take all 4 blinds and play
alone - OR picker takes any two cards from the blind pile (face down, of course)
and the next player to his/her left, is the partner and takes the remaining two
cards.

Then of course there are the usual 3 and 4 handed versions, but I'd be
interested in hearing more about your 24-card game. Please e-mail me with your
response. Happy playing!

ferdsgrrl <dselhorst1219@...> wrote:
I live in Southwestern Ohio, but learned a variation on Sheephead from
my husband's family. We play with only 24 cards, no blinds, and trump
ranking is abit different. Qc, Qs, Jc, Js, Jh, Jd, Ace or "Fox" of
Diamonds, 10 d, Kd, Qd, 9d. Scoring is different too. Has anyone
heard of this version before? Let me know! Thanks!
